The Right Questions to Ask During Your Plastic Surgery Consultation

plastic surgeryDeciding to have plastic surgery is a very serious and deeply personal decision. Many procedures can be life-changing, but the process can be stressful. Many patients weigh the benefits and risks in their minds for extended periods of time before scheduling a consultation with a plastic surgeon. Here are a few suggestions of what questions to ask in order to have a valuable consultation experience.

  1. Are you a member of the Canadian Society for Aesthetic Plastic Surgery? This question is important because surgeons belonging to this society must be board certified and maintain a specific level of professionalism, in addition to being committed to continuing education.
  2. Ask the surgeon his or her specific experience with the procedure you are interested in. Many surgeons have a specialty procedure that they have the most experience with.
  3. What results should I expect? It is important to discuss your surgical goals with your plastic surgeon so that realistic expectations can be established. Ask to see the surgeon’s before and after portfolio so you can adjust your expectations accordingly.
  4. What will my procedure involve? Where will my scars be? Take the time to ask your surgeon about the steps of your procedure so that you fully understand what your surgery entails. Ask if it is possible for scars to be hidden or minimized.
  5. How long will it take for me to recover? One of the most common questions following plastic surgery is “When can I go back to work?” A timeline for healing is unique to each patient and the procedure he or she has undergone. It is important that prior to your surgery, you have discussed probable recovery time with your surgeon.
